Did you know that Google's carbon emissions increased by 11% last year despite its sustainability goals? It’s a startling revelation from their 2025 sustainability report, highlighting a puzzle we all face: how do we balance incredible tech advancements with the urgent climate crisis? If you’re on a fertility journey, especially exploring at-home insemination, this might seem unrelated—but it’s not. Let’s unpack why.

The Verge recently reported that Google’s carbon footprint jumped to 11.5 million metric tons of CO2, driven largely by their investment in AI and data centers (read more here). This trend underscores a broader issue: technology’s environmental toll is growing even as we rely on it more for health, communication, and family-building solutions.
